Cytometers and cell sorters use laser beams to analyse, sort, and separate cells or organisms flowing in a stable stream of fluid. “Imagine shining a beam of light through a stream of water as droplets pass by,” said Diana Ordonez, the head of the Flow Cytometry Core Facility at EMBL Heidelberg.

Web1 Jun 2024 · There are three main components of a flow cytometer that allow all of this to be possible. They are the fluidics, optics, and electronics.
